春风项目四线(合箱线、总装线)
cl
2024-02-17 7ff5e9edadf446d0d033574a7b0ae802f5ac2233
提交 | 用户 | 时间
fd2207 1 package com.jcdm.system.service;
2
3 import com.jcdm.common.core.domain.model.LoginUser;
4 import com.jcdm.system.domain.SysUserOnline;
5
6 /**
7  * 在线用户 服务层
8  * 
9  * @author jc
10  */
11 public interface ISysUserOnlineService
12 {
13     /**
14      * 通过登录地址查询信息
15      * 
16      * @param ipaddr 登录地址
17      * @param user 用户信息
18      * @return 在线用户信息
19      */
20     public SysUserOnline selectOnlineByIpaddr(String ipaddr, LoginUser user);
21
22     /**
23      * 通过用户名称查询信息
24      * 
25      * @param userName 用户名称
26      * @param user 用户信息
27      * @return 在线用户信息
28      */
29     public SysUserOnline selectOnlineByUserName(String userName, LoginUser user);
30
31     /**
32      * 通过登录地址/用户名称查询信息
33      * 
34      * @param ipaddr 登录地址
35      * @param userName 用户名称
36      * @param user 用户信息
37      * @return 在线用户信息
38      */
39     public SysUserOnline selectOnlineByInfo(String ipaddr, String userName, LoginUser user);
40
41     /**
42      * 设置在线用户信息
43      * 
44      * @param user 用户信息
45      * @return 在线用户
46      */
47     public SysUserOnline loginUserToUserOnline(LoginUser user);
48 }